Oxymoral

What is Oxymoral?


1.

1. Moral principles, beliefs or behavior which are contradictory or hypocritical in nature.

2. An ethical paradox.

Etymology: A grammatical contraction derived from the words oxymoron and moral.

Both parents oxymoral behavior sent mixed messages to their children.

The leader's oxymoral policies ironically backfired in his face.

See hypocrite, poser, phoney, two-faced, paradox
